Maryland and Missouri Vote to Legalize Cannabis
Voters in Maryland and Missouri voted to legalize recreational marijuana in the recent midterm elections, bringing the total number of states that have legalized cannabis for use by adults to 21. Ballot measures to legalize marijuana failed to win a majority of votes in Arkansas, North Dakota and South Dakota, however, with voters in those …

Medical cannabis for doggies, kitties is fully legalized in California
Newly enacted bill in California allows veterinarians to “recommend” medical cannabis products for their furry patients.
